**Minutes — Management Meeting, Pilot Churn Review**

The committee reviewed churn figures for the Selworth pilot. Monthly attrition reached 9%, concentrated among customers onboarded in the first wave. Root causes identified: onboarding friction and unclear pricing tiers. Remedial actions assigned to the product group, with a revised flow due within three weeks. The incoming director will receive the full dataset at handover. Strategic implications were discussed and are summarised confidentially below.

internal memo for kawip-hadug: Headcount on the Wenwyn team goes from 7 to 140 by the end of January. Gross margin on Wenwyn came in at 20 percent against a plan of 15 percent.

The Chalkline solver enforces hard ceilings on search time, candidate timetables held in memory, and constraint-propagation depth. Reviewers should verify that any change keeps the solver's worst case bounded, since the Ashgrove district runs it nightly on shared hardware. Exceeding a quota aborts the run cleanly and logs the partial best solution. The quotas currently in force are:

tuning table, yajog-yahof:
BUDGETS = {
    "lamvan": 303,
    "wenox": 460,
    "fenvan": 525,
}

Welcome to the Penndrake support crew! One thing you'll hit in week one: rounding errors in currency conversion. Our Quillex engine converts at six decimal places, then rounds at display time, so a customer's statement can look off by a cent. It's not a bug — point them to the rounding policy article. If you need to re-run a conversion audit, you'll use the Quillex recovery vault. The passphrase to unlock it is below.

strongbox words: fraath-isteth

## Service Accounts & Dependency Pinning

Hey, welcome aboard! Quick rule for anything touching the Brindlewick build farm: every dependency gets pinned to an exact version. No ranges, no "latest" — we learned that lesson the hard way during the Quillhaven outage. The `pinbot` service account enforces this on every merge, so don't fight it. If you need pinbot to scan a private repo, authenticate against the Lockstep registry using the key below.

gateway credential: kto23_LX9A4ys6i4nzHtpOLNLodKK